Valerii Zaluzhnyi served as the Commander-in-Chief of the Armed Forces of Ukraine in 2021-2024. He was named by Time magazine as one of the 100 most influential people in the world in 2022. In March 2024, Zaluzhnyi was appointed the Ukrainian ambassador to the United Kingdom.
Former Ukrainian military chief Valerii Zaluzhnyi warns of a growing authoritarian alliance threatening global democracy, urging NATO to adapt to new warfare realities.
